Overview

Motion Family Planner brings calendars, tasks, and scheduling together to help families stay organized. Instead of manually coordinating school events, appointments, activities, and household responsibilities across multiple apps, Motion uses intelligent scheduling to keep plans up to date.

Parents can organize family commitments, manage recurring routines, and reduce scheduling conflicts from a single workspace. Automatic scheduling helps adapt plans when priorities change, making it easier to keep track of busy family life.

Motion is especially useful for households balancing work, school, extracurricular activities, and shared responsibilities. While it is designed primarily as a productivity platform rather than a dedicated family organizer, many families can adapt it successfully for collaborative planning.

For parents who want a structured digital planning system instead of scattered calendars and handwritten reminders, Motion offers a polished and flexible solution.

Not ideal for

It is not a dedicated parental control app, child safety platform, or family location service, and some advanced features require a paid subscription.

Pros

  • Automatically schedules tasks and events
  • Helps reduce calendar conflicts
  • Works across multiple devices
  • Supports recurring routines
  • Easy to organize shared responsibilities
  • Modern and intuitive interface

Cons

  • Requires a subscription for full functionality
  • Learning curve for new users
  • Not designed specifically for parenting
  • Requires internet access for most features
